Windows에서 명령 프롬프트 및“실행”프로그램을 비활성화하는 방법

0
518

상단

명령 프롬프트와 실행 프로그램은 Windows 세계에서 매우 강력한 도구입니다. 컴퓨터의 특정 사용자가 액세스 할 수없는 경우 너무 어렵지 않습니다.

관련 : Windows 10에서 명령 프롬프트를 여는 10 가지 방법

Windows를 사용하면 명령 프롬프트를 쉽게 열 수 있으며 모든 유용한 기능이 있습니다. 또한 경험이 많지 않은 사람들에게는 위험한 도구가 될 수 있습니다. 많은 힘이 노출되고 때로는 명령의 전체적인 결과를 이해하기가 어렵 기 때문입니다. Run 프로그램은 비슷하게 위험합니다. 명령 프롬프트에서 사용하는 것과 동일한 명령을 많이 수행 할 수 있습니다. 컴퓨터의 특정 사용자에 대해 이러한 기능을 비활성화하려는 모든 종류의 이유가 있습니다. 가족 용 컴퓨터를 공유하는 어린이가 있거나 손님이 나와 ​​함께있을 때 컴퓨터를 사용하도록 할 수 있습니다. 또는 비즈니스 컴퓨터를 고객을위한 키오스크로 실행하고 있으며이를 잠 가야합니다. 당신의 이유가 무엇이든, 우리는 당신을 위해 해결했습니다.

개인 사용자 : 레지스트리를 편집하여 명령 프롬프트 비활성화 및 프로그램 실행

홈 버전의 Windows를 사용하는 경우 이러한 변경을 수행하려면 Windows 레지스트리를 편집해야합니다. Windows Pro 또는 Enterprise가 있지만 레지스트리에서 작업하는 것이 더 편한 경우 에도이 방법을 사용할 수 있습니다. 그러나 Pro 또는 Enterprise를 사용하는 경우 다음 섹션에 설명 된대로보다 쉬운 로컬 그룹 정책 편집기를 사용하는 것이 좋습니다. 그러나 레지스트리를 편집 할 때는 다음과 같이 로그온해야합니다. 종료를 비활성화하려는 사용자입니다.

관련 : 전문가처럼 레지스트리 편집기를 사용하는 법 배우기

표준 경고 : 레지스트리 편집기는 강력한 도구이므로 잘못 사용하면 시스템이 불안정하거나 작동하지 않을 수 있습니다. 이것은 매우 간단한 해킹이며 지침을 준수하는 한 아무런 문제가 없습니다. 즉, 이전에 사용해 본 적이 없다면 시작하기 전에 레지스트리 편집기를 사용하는 방법에 대해 읽어보십시오. 변경하기 전에 반드시 레지스트리 (및 컴퓨터)를 백업하십시오.

시작하려면 이러한 변경을 수행 할 사용자로 로그인하십시오. 시작을 누르고 “regedit”를 입력하여 레지스트리 편집기를 엽니 다. Enter 키를 눌러 레지스트리 편집기를 열고 PC를 변경할 수있는 권한을 부여하십시오. 먼저 명령 프롬프트를 비활성화합니다. 레지스트리 편집기에서 왼쪽 사이드 바를 사용하여 다음 키로 이동하십시오.

HKEY_CURRENT_USERSOFTWAREPoliciesMicrosoftWindowsSystem

cmd_reg1

다음으로 해당 키에 새로운 가치를 창출 할 것입니다. 시스템 아이콘을 마우스 오른쪽 단추로 클릭하고 새로 작성> DWORD (32 비트) 값을 선택하십시오. 새로운 가치를 지으십시오 DisableCMD .

cmd_reg2

이제 그 값을 수정하겠습니다. 새로운 것을 두 번 클릭하십시오 DisableCMD 값을 설정하고 값을 1 “값 데이터”상자에서 확인을 클릭하십시오.

cmd_reg3

명령 프롬프트 자체가 비활성화되었으므로 다음 단계는 Run 프로그램을 비활성화하는 것입니다. 레지스트리 편집기에서 다음 키로 이동하십시오.

HKEY_CURRENT_USERSOFTWAREMicrosoftWindowsCurrentVersionPoliciesExplorer

cmd_reg4

Explorer 아이콘을 마우스 오른쪽 단추로 클릭하고 새로 작성> DWORD (32 비트) 값을 선택하십시오. 새로운 가치를 지으십시오 NoRun .

cmd_reg5

새로운 것을 두 번 클릭하십시오 NoRun 값을 입력하고 '값 데이터'상자를 1 .

cmd_reg6

확인을 클릭하고 레지스트리 편집기를 종료하고 컴퓨터를 다시 시작한 후 변경 한 사용자로 로그인하십시오. 해당 사용자는 더 이상 프로그램 실행 또는 명령 프롬프트에 액세스 할 수 없습니다. 비활성화 된 상태에서 실행 명령에 액세스하려고하면 다음 오류 메시지가 표시됩니다.

shutdown_restrict

명령 프롬프트 또는 프로그램 실행을 다시 활성화하려면 해당 사용자로 다시 로그인하고 레지스트리를 열고 값을 다시 0으로 설정하십시오.

원 클릭 레지스트리 해킹 다운로드

cmd_hacks

레지스트리에 직접 들어가고 싶지 않다면 사용할 수있는 다운로드 가능한 레지스트리 핵을 만들었습니다. 명령 프롬프트와 실행 프로그램을 모두 비활성화하고 다시 활성화하는 해킹이 있습니다. 다음 ZIP 파일에는 네 가지 핵이 모두 포함되어 있습니다. 사용하려는 것을 두 번 클릭하고 프롬프트를 클릭하십시오. 원하는 해킹을 적용한 후 컴퓨터를 다시 시작하십시오.

명령 프롬프트 및 실행 해킹

관련 : 자신의 Windows 레지스트리 해킹을 만드는 방법

이러한 핵은 실제로 적용 가능한 키이며 이전 섹션에서 언급 한 값으로 분리 한 다음 .REG 파일로 내보냈습니다. 활성화 해킹 중 하나를 실행하면 해당 특정 값이 1로 변경됩니다. 활성화 해킹 중 하나를 실행하면 해당 특정 값이 다시 0으로 설정됩니다. 해킹.

Pro 및 Enterprise 사용자 : 명령 프롬프트 비활성화 및 로컬 그룹 정책 편집기로 프로그램 실행

Windows Pro 또는 Enterprise를 사용하는 경우 명령 프롬프트를 비활성화하고 프로그램을 실행하는 가장 쉬운 방법은 로컬 그룹 정책 편집기를 사용하는 것입니다. 매우 강력한 도구이므로 전에 사용해 본 적이 없다면 시간을내어 할 수있는 일을 배우는 것이 좋습니다. 또한 회사 네트워크를 사용하는 경우 모두에게 호의를 베풀고 관리자에게 먼저 확인하십시오. 업무용 컴퓨터가 도메인의 일부인 경우에도 로컬 그룹 정책을 대체하는 도메인 그룹 정책의 일부일 수도 있습니다. 또한 특정 사용자를위한 정책 조정을 만들 예정이므로 해당 사용자를위한 정책 콘솔을 만드는 추가 단계를 수행해야합니다.

관련 : 그룹 정책 편집기를 사용하여 PC 조정

Windows Pro 또는 Enterprise에서 정책을 적용하려는 사용자를 위해 만든 MSC 파일을 찾아 두 번 클릭하여 연 다음 예를 클릭하여 변경합니다. 해당 사용자의 그룹 정책 창의 왼쪽 창에서 사용자 구성> 관리 템플릿> 시스템으로 드릴 다운하십시오. 오른쪽에서 “명령 프롬프트에 대한 액세스 방지”항목을 찾아 두 번 클릭하십시오.

cmd_gp1

정책을 사용으로 설정 한 다음 확인을 클릭하십시오. 명령 프롬프트 스크립팅을 비활성화 할 수있는 드롭 다운 메뉴도 있습니다. 이렇게하면 사용자가 스크립트 및 배치 파일을 실행할 수 없게됩니다. 정통한 사용자의 명령 줄 기능을 실제로 차단하려는 경우이 설정을 켜십시오. 명령 프롬프트에서 쉽게 액세스를 제거하려는 경우 (또는 Windows에서 여전히 로그 오프, 로그온 또는 기타 배치 파일을 실행할 수 있어야하는 경우) 설정을 해제하십시오.

cmd_gp2

다음으로 Run 프로그램에 액세스하는 기능을 비활성화합니다. 해당 사용자의 그룹 정책 창으로 돌아가서 사용자 구성> 관리 템플릿> 시작 메뉴 및 작업 표시 줄을 찾으십시오. 오른쪽에서 “시작 메뉴에서 실행 제거”항목을 찾아 두 번 클릭하십시오.

cmd_gp3

정책을 사용으로 설정 한 다음 확인을 클릭하십시오.

cmd_gp4

이제 그룹 정책 편집기를 종료 할 수 있습니다. 새 설정을 테스트하려면 로그 오프 한 다음 변경 한 사용자 (또는 사용자 그룹의 구성원)로 다시 로그온하십시오. 명령 프롬프트 또는 프로그램 실행을 다시 활성화하려면 편집기를 사용하여 항목을 구성되지 않음 (또는 비활성화 됨)으로 다시 설정하십시오.

그리고 그게 다야. 약간의 작업이 필요하지만 사용자로부터 이러한 강력한 도구를 잠그는 것은 그리 어렵지 않습니다.